Subject: Order-cutoff rule heads up

Hey Priya,

Welcome to the Flourbound on-call rotation! One thing that bites everyone: the bakery order-cutoff job runs at 14:00 local, not UTC, and it's per-store. If a store's clock config drifts, orders sneak in past cutoff and the fulfillment queue gets angry. Since you're reviewing Tomas's cutoff refactor this week, watch for any hardcoded timezone assumptions — that's the classic mistake. The cutoff logic and its edge cases are written up here.

runbook for tafof-yawif: https://confluence.tolvaqsys.internal/display/display/browse/pages/7be3

Welcome to the Addrly widget team. The autocomplete widget queries the Pinpost geocoding backend; suggestions are cached client-side for 60 seconds. Clone the repo, run the bootstrap script, and copy .env.sample to .env.local. Most defaults work out of the box. The only thing you must add yourself is the Pinpost API key, on the line directly below this sentence.

secret setting of yagef-baweg: RELAY_SECRET29=cb53deb59a49ed54d9f43599b54ca

### Changed defaults — Pondwright LB health checks

Heads up, support folks: we tightened the default health checks on the Pondwright load balancer. Unhealthy nodes now get pulled faster, so brief blips may show as node rotations in the dashboard — that's expected, not an outage. The new default values are listed below.

settings of tagag-fajeg:
[quenion]
host = quenion.ordingrid.corp
user = quenion_svc
database = quenion_prod

## Dedupe On-Call Basics

Signalfold collapses duplicate alerts before they page you. If it stalls, alerts multiply fast — restart the worker, then clear the queue. To unlock the admin panel after a restart, you'll be asked for the recovery passphrase. Don't guess; wrong attempts lock it for an hour. It is the following.

strongbox words: sorir-belvan-rusix-ulays-ralmir-praix-eliir-tamax-praael-druael-julir-tamius-jorir